What Is an Intensive Outpatient Program?

An Intensive Outpatient Program (IOP) is a structured level of addiction treatment that typically meets three to five days per week for approximately three hours per session. IOP provides more structure and support than traditional outpatient therapy while offering greater flexibility than Partial Hospitalization Programs (PHP).

IOP is designed for individuals who are medically and psychiatrically stable but still benefit from consistent therapeutic engagement, accountability, and relapse-prevention support while managing work, school, or family responsibilities.

Who Is IOP Right For?

IOP may be a good fit if you:

  • Have completed detox, residential treatment, or PHP and need continued support
  • Are medically and psychiatrically stable but benefit from structured care
  • Have a safe and supportive living environment
  • Need more structure than standard outpatient therapy
  • Are returning to work, school, or family responsibilities

IOP may not be appropriate if you require 24-hour medical or psychiatric monitoring. Our clinical team will help guide you to the appropriate level of care.

What a Typical Week Looks Like

Most patients attend IOP sessions 3-5 days per week, with each session lasting approximately 3 hours. Depending on clinical needs and availability, both daytime and evening options may be offered to accommodate work and family schedules.

Programming typically includes 9-15 hours of treatment per week, combining group therapy, individual counseling, and skills training focused on relapse prevention, emotional regulation, stress management, and healthy communication.

Programming intensity is individualized and typically ranges from approximately 9 to 19 hours per week, delivered across multiple days, depending on clinical needs and progress in treatment.

Care includes coordination with medical and psychiatric providers as needed, with psychiatric consultation available for medication management and ongoing monitoring of co-occurring mental health conditions.

IOP typically lasts between 4 and 12 weeks, depending on progress and clinical recommendations. Treatment duration is individualized based on your needs and goals.

PHP (Partial Hospitalization Program) involves more hours per week (typically 4-6 hours per day, 5 days per week) and a higher level of structure, while IOP provides flexibility with continued clinical support (typically 3 hours per session, 3-5 days per week). PHP is appropriate for those needing more intensive support than IOP.

What Happens After IOP?

After completing IOP, patients may transition to standard outpatient programming, alumni support programs, community-based recovery resources, or continued individual counseling. Ongoing support helps reinforce long-term recovery and provides accountability as you maintain independence.
